Labradorite, a feldspar mineral, can display an iridescent optical effect (or Schiller) known as labradorescence. It is an intermediate to calcic member of the plagioclase series. The streak is white, like most silicates. As with all plagioclase members, the crystal system is triclinic. It occurs as clear, white to gray, blocky to lath shaped grains in common mafic igneous rocks such as basalt and gabbro, as well as in anorthosites.

Mineral Information – Labradorite Feldspar

Labradorite is a calcium-sodium feldspar belonging to the plagioclase feldspar series. It crystallises in the triclinic crystal system and is best known for its remarkable optical effect known as labradorescence.

Labradorescence is caused by light interference within microscopic lamellar structures inside the stone. When light strikes the surface at certain angles, flashes of blue, green, gold, or grey can appear across the mineral. This natural iridescence makes labradorite one of the most visually distinctive feldspar minerals.

The base colour of labradorite is typically grey to dark charcoal, often with shimmering internal colour zones revealed under direct light. With a Mohs hardness of approximately 6 to 6.5, labradorite is durable enough for carving and display, while still requiring care to protect its polished surfaces.

Geological Formation

Labradorite forms in igneous rocks such as basalt, gabbro, and anorthosite. It develops during the slow cooling of magma, allowing feldspar crystals to grow within the host rock. Major deposits are found in regions such as Madagascar, Canada, Finland, and Russia, with Madagascar being especially well known for producing highly labradorescent material suitable for carving.

The carving process enhances the stone’s natural colour flashes, as curved surfaces allow shifting light angles to reveal multiple tones across the sculpture.
